A-4-5
PDO Mapping Objects
The PDO mapping objects for the EtherCAT Slave Unit are listed in the following table.

Subindexes 01 hex and on give the mapped application object information.

Bits 16 to 31: Index of the assigned object
Bits 8 to 15: Subindex of the assigned object
Bits 0 to 7: Bit length of the assigned object (i.e., a bit length of 32 bits is given as 20 hex)
Receive PDO Mapping Objects for the EtherCAT Slave Unit
The indexes from 1700 to 1703 hex are for receive PDO mapping objects for the EtherCAT Slave Unit.
